Healthy Turkey Avocado Wraps

  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 large whole wheat tortillas
  • 1 lb sliced turkey breast (preferably roasted or cooked)
  • 2 ripe avocados, sliced
  • 1 cup shredded lettuce or spinach leaves
  • 1 medium tomato, thinly sliced
  • ½ red onion, thinly sliced
  • ¼ cup light mayonnaise or Greek yogurt (optional)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Optional: sliced cheese, pickles, or mustard for extra flavor

Instructions

  1. Start by gathering all your ingredients. Slice the avocado, tomato, and red onion thinly. Rinse and dry the leafy greens. Lay out the tortillas on a clean surface.
  2. Lay a tortilla flat and spread a thin layer of mayonnaise or Greek yogurt if using. Place slices of turkey evenly over the tortilla, then layer with avocado slices, lettuce or spinach, tomato, and onion.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Carefully roll the tortilla tightly from one edge to the other, folding in the sides as you go to create a secure wrap. Repeat with remaining tortillas and ingredients.
  4. Slice each wrap diagonally if desired and serve immediately. For portable lunches, wrap in foil or parchment paper. These wraps are perfect for on-the-go meals or picnics.

Notes

  • Use ripe avocados for the best creaminess and flavor.
  • Wrap tightly to prevent fillings from spilling out.
  • Prepare ingredients ahead of time for quick assembly.
  • You can add sliced cheese, sprouts, or mustard for extra flavor variations.
